What is Microsoft Azure IoT integration?
Azure IoT integration is the practice of connecting Azure IoT to the rest of your operation - ERP, CMMS, historians and AI - so device telemetry is usable everywhere it matters. Rayven delivers it as part of an Industrial AI Data Fabric, reading data alongside your platform, never running as your IoT platform.
How does Rayven connect Azure IoT to other systems?
Rayven reads Azure IoT Hub over MQTT and AMQP, subscribes to Event Hubs routing and calls the Azure Digital Twins and IoT Hub REST APIs through the Rayven integration layer. Device messages, twin updates and events flow as first-class integration events in real-time, bidirectionally where scoped. See the Rayven Platform.
What systems can Rayven connect Azure IoT to?
Rayven connects Azure IoT to 1,228+ systems including ERP, CMMS, historians, data warehouses and AI, plus sibling IoT platforms like AWS IoT and Siemens Insights Hub. Custom and legacy connections are part of done-for-you delivery.
Does Rayven control or replace Azure IoT?
No. Rayven reads and unifies Azure IoT telemetry and sits alongside your subscription; it is not an IoT platform and does not replace Azure IoT. Supervised writeback of desired properties runs only where you scope it, under audit and role-based control. Rayven never issues device commands and leaves the control and safety loop untouched. What are the technical specifics of Microsoft Azure IoT integration with Rayven?
Rayven connects to Azure IoT through the IoT Hub MQTT and AMQP endpoints, Event Hubs message routing and the Azure Digital Twins and IoT Hub REST APIs, authenticated with SAS tokens or Azure AD. Device-to-cloud telemetry streams in real-time; Digital Twins DTDL models, relationships and reported properties are read through the API and batched so large backfills never throttle the hub. Messages, twin updates, events and metadata are preserved with field-level mapping into ERP, CMMS and AI targets. Per-subscription and per-hub scope is rolled up to one cross-site model via Rayven's asset-master layer. Devices reachable only over Modbus or OPC-UA through Azure IoT Edge are normalised alongside hub data. Where scoped, supervised writeback of desired properties runs to device twins under role-based control and full audit logging; Rayven never issues device commands and leaves the control and safety loop untouched. Validated against Azure IoT Hub, DPS and Azure Digital Twins across single and multi-hub architectures.
